theaulddubliner;436392 said:
@BlankTim
if you go to the end of the first post in this thread there is a zip file attached - unzip that to get gmail.css
gmail.css is the file that contains all the style changes for gmail
the line @import gmail.css just calls this file into usercontent and makes it work in firefox
@warius
It definitely woks on firefox 2.0+
